Transaction 9486e58c39462598602ef48cb28b198318222e711f2ccf346ea631958f688199

2 Input
2 Outputs
  • 9486e58c39462598602ef48cb28b198318222e711f2ccf346ea631958f688199:0
  • value  138362
    address  3BPFATcrnf1XD9o2uahrTvEhqp5fitXA5j
  • 9486e58c39462598602ef48cb28b198318222e711f2ccf346ea631958f688199:1
  • value  1920
    address  15vQFRv1uvxywV7zzgoBz6ZkHLBjSpPb6d